What is the significance of the fire in 'Lord of the Flies'?

Back

The fire represents hope for rescue and the boys' connection to civilization. It is a signal for passing ships.

Who are the littluns in 'Lord of the Flies'?

Back

The littluns are the younger boys on the island, representing innocence and vulnerability.

What does Ralph prioritize in the group?

Back

Ralph prioritizes maintaining the signal fire and building shelters to ensure the group's survival and hope for rescue.

Why are the littluns afraid at night?

Back

They are afraid of the 'beastie', a symbol of their fears and the unknown.

What role does Piggy play in the group?

Back

Piggy represents intellect and reason, often providing logical solutions and ideas.

How does Jack's character evolve in the first six chapters?

Back

Jack transitions from a choir leader to a more savage and power-driven character, focusing on hunting and dominance.

What does the conch shell symbolize?

Back

The conch shell symbolizes order, authority, and democratic power among the boys.
